A defect report runs across a whole property listing everything found. An investigation isolates one failure and works out the cause, which is the document that matters when fault is being argued rather than existence.
It is written to be usable, though the tribunal expects a report prepared to NCAT Procedural Direction 3, which we produce separately. Plenty of disputes close before reaching that point.
We record what failed and the requirement it failed against. Where the remedy needs design, that is an engineer's certificate and the report says so instead of guessing.
